Output de93740fc8e03377991ccf51e1d95434ea124d7dc7ab0b2533da97cada983590:0

value
2440689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0653022921f63957aa1338d020a158ad238e2235 OP_EQUAL
address
32GTRDqxtuYLuhtWD5fha1MrFXoXYMXPpq
transaction
de93740fc8e03377991ccf51e1d95434ea124d7dc7ab0b2533da97cada983590
confirmations
288898
spent
true